Optogel for Biophotonics Applications
Optogels possess a unique combination of optical and mechanical properties that make them suitable candidates for biophotonics applications. These composites, characterized by their high transparency and variable refractive index, enable efficient light transmission through biological tissues. This capability is crucial for a variety of biophotonic applications, including opaltogel optical imaging, photodynamic therapy, and biosensing. Optogels can be modified with specific ligands to target to cells of interest. This selectivity allows for the development of ultra-sensitive biophotonic sensors and diagnostic tools.
Furthermore, optogels can be eliminated effectively within the body, minimizing potential harmfulness. Their unique biocompatibility and inherent optical properties make optogels promising candidates for a range of future biophotonics applications.
Tailoring Optogel Properties for Enhanced Performance
Optimizing the efficacy of optogels hinges on precisely controlling their physical properties. By modifying factors such as polymer content, crosslinking density, and dimension, researchers can augment optogel sensitivity to light stimuli. This fine-tuning allows for the development of advanced optogels with customized properties for applications in drug delivery.
For instance, increasing the crosslinking density can boost the mechanical strength of an optogel, making it suitable for robust applications. Conversely, incorporating functionalized nanoparticles into the matrix can enhance its optical properties.
Additionally, by investigating novel material blends, researchers can discover optogels with remarkable features for a wider range of applications.
